SERVICE AND ADJUSTMENTS
TO REMOVE WHEELS (See Fig. 22)
•  Remove the wheel pin and retainer pin and remove 
wheel from axle.
NOTE: To seal punctures or prevent flat tires due to slow 
leaks, tire sealant may be purchased from your local parts 
dealer. Tire sealant also prevents tire dry rot and cor ro sion.

CARBURETOR
Your carburetor is not adjustable. Engine performance 
should not be affected at altitudes up to 2,134 meters. If 
your engine does not operate properly due to suspected 
carburetor problems, take your snow thrower to a service 
center/department.
ENGINE SPEED
Never tamper with the engine governor, which is factory set 
for proper engine speed. Overspeeding the engine above 
the factory high speed setting can be dangerous and will 
void the warranty. If you think the engine-governed high 
speed needs adjusting, contact a service center/depart-
ment, which has the proper equipment and experience to 
make any necessary ad just ments.

DRIVE BELT REPLACEMENT (See Fig. 21)
TO REMOVE DRIVE BELT
1.  Remove auger belt.  See “TO REMOVE AUGER BELT” 
in this section.
2.  Remove tensioner spring attached to drive belt tensioner 
arm.
3.  Remove return spring holding the swing plate in place.
4.  Remove arm bolt and drive belt tensioner arm.
5.  Remove pulley bolt and washer, engine pulley, and drive 
belt from engine.
6.  Remove the top bolt holding the swing plate to frame 
assembly.  
7.  Pivot and hold the swing plate away from snow thrower 
and remove drive belt from drive pulley.
TO INSTALL DRIVE BELT
1.  Pivot and hold swing plate away from snow thrower.  
Place drive belt onto drive pulley. Ensure drive belt is 
routed in drive pulley groove properly before lowering 
swing plate.
2.  Install previously removed top bolt.  Tighten securely.
3.  Place drive belt into engine pulley groove before installing 
onto engine shaft.  
4.  Install previously removed washer and bolt and secure 
engine pulley onto engine.  Tighten securely (30-35 Ft. 
Lbs. / 41-47 Nm).
5.  Install drive belt tensioner arm and arm bolt onto engine.  
Tighten securely.
6.  Install return spring onto swing plate.
7.  Install tensioner spring onto tensioner arm.
8.  Operate all controls to ensure belts are installed properly 
and that all components are moving correctly.
9.  Install auger belt.  See “TO INSTALL AUGER BELT” in 
this section.
AFTER REPLACING BELT(S)
1.  INSTALL BELT COVER and two (2) screws. Tighten 
securely.
2. INSTALL DISCHARGE CHUTE – See “INSTALL 
DISCHARGE CHUTE / CHUTE Rotator HEAD” in the 
Assembly section of this manual.
